A Scottish FA disciplinary committee decided on the length of Lennon’s ban after a three-hour hearing.

Celtic’s Neil Lennon, centre, was restrained by his team-mates after being sent off by referee Stuart Dougal in the 2005 Old Firm derby at Ibrox

Lennon had been shown a red card for arguing with the match officials after the final whistle following Celtic’s loss at Ibrox in August, before he pushed aside the assistant referee and then barged into Dougal. Neil Lennon spent seven-and-a-half years as a player at Celtic after joining from Leicester in December 2000

Celtic said in a statement after the hearing: “We are satisfied with the process, today’s outcome and pleased that common sense has prevailed.”
